Output 3c138813695d951a50ad95863b6df808eb029ca8588fae0852d2c66e633efed7:3

value
42240
script pubkey
OP_0 OP_PUSHBYTES_20 4da1eb6314d3dae6a76c0a2e41afc9030fbfcae9
address
bc1qfks7kcc560dwdfmvpghyrt7fqv8mljhftx9qf2
transaction
3c138813695d951a50ad95863b6df808eb029ca8588fae0852d2c66e633efed7
confirmations
141230
spent
true